Although aesthetics may be a significant factor in your selection, don’t forget to think about the more practical aspects of the lunch box as well. Keep these four points in mind to help you decide!
We've broken down the benefits and drawbacks of commonly used lunchbox materials so you can choose which one suits your needs! A mix of materials is often used for added functionality.
Plastic lunchboxes are either made of polypropylene or polyethylene terephthalate (PET), and both are recyclable and easy to wash. They are durable and flexible too, so they can withstand regular knocks and bumps without breaking apart.
Not all plastic is microwavable or insulates food well, so make sure to double-check those points if they are important to you.
Plastic containers usually come in a variety of colors, which makes them aesthetically pleasing and appeals to kids. Customers should make sure that the box they buy is non-toxic, BPA-free, and made from food-grade materials.
BPA is an industrial chemical that has been shown to leak out of plastic and into food. The FDA says it's safe at low levels, although there are growing concerns that it can negatively impact your health if consumed. Most people agree it's best to steer clear of BPA just to be safe!
Stainless steel boxes have a longer shelf life and are non-toxic. These boxes are slightly heavier than plastic but are more durable and rigid when compared to other boxes. They might get dented if dropped or knocked regularly.
Steel boxes are usually housed in leak-proof containers to ensure cleanliness and the safety of other items inside a school bag. They are usually easy-to-clean and dishwasher-safe too! Food doesn’t tend to stick to the box, and it doesn’t take a lot of effort to remove any waste.
Fabric lunch bags are usually made of 420D polyester or 600D polyester, which helps to insulate food. These lunch bags come in various aesthetically pleasing varieties and are surprisingly lightweight. They're also easy to carry, even though most have a higher capacity than other boxes.
However, they may be more difficult to clean and don't always provide the same protection compared to lunchboxes made of rigid material.
Picking a lunchbox size for your child can be a tricky business! There is no certainty on what amount of food they might consume. The amount of physical activity your kid has to go through the day might make a huge difference in their appetite too!
We generally advise picking a larger lunchbox. As your kid grows, their appetite will grow as well. Plus, sometimes kids like sharing food with their friends, and a smaller lunchbox might limit this social fun!
However, getting a lunch box that is too big could be a problem. Kids might find it difficult to carry around, and it may not fit in their backpacks. Some boxes have extra pockets to store utensils, drinks, and other small items. This can add convenience and can help maximize the storage of smaller lunchboxes.
Having one big section in a lunch box is convenient for a child who likes to have multiple servings of only one or two types of food per meal. This can also be good for packaged foods, as the packaging tends to take up more space.
However, for parents who like to pack multiple things in a lunchbox per meal for your kid, having multiple compartments can be a blessing. You can pack a balanced meal and little ones don't have to stress about their food touching!
There is much less of a chance of food getting mixed up too! Plus, for eco-conscious families, multiple leak-proof compartments can save you from using plastic baggies to store food.
Insulated lunch boxes are a must for parents who like to provide their kid with a hot meal or cold drinks for lunch. These lunch boxes usually have a layer of vacuum between the two walls of the box or use insulating materials to make sure that the desired temperature is maintained until lunchtime.
This makes it super easy to carry around extremely hot or cold food. The box itself will not be affected by the temperature of the food inside due to the insulation. You don't have to worry about hot handles or freezing sides!
Some lunchboxes come with insulated compartments inside as well. These are amazing as they allow you to store all kinds of food in the same box. This can save you from having to pack an extra thermos for hot dishes.
If you’re going to be cleaning the box, you’ll want to make sure it’s easy to clean. Along with the material, the structure is also important in determining the elbow grease required.
For example, a box with many nooks and crannies might end up taking a significant amount of time to clean, as those areas of the box might not be very accessible. Sharp corners and small grooves can be hard to get to, which means extra effort and time for you.
If want to use a dishwasher, make sure all parts of the lunch box are dishwasher-safe or are easily removable if not. Most dish-washer safe lunchboxes are top rack only, as being exposed to hot water directly or for too long may warp plastic or other soft materials.
Fabric lunch bags are often recommended to be dry cleaned, which is usually impractical for most parents. Usually, a good wiping-down with an antibacterial cleaner is enough!
With any lunchbox, it's recommended to let it dry completely after washing to avoid mold. Moisture can easily get trapped in grooves or hinges, especially since this a product that gets used and washed almost every day.
